Interested in Joining the NJAFM?

Your membership is critical for NJAFM's continued success and development.

In 2011, membership fees helped in the following ways:

  • Holding the premiere conference specifically focused on floodplain management in New Jersey in October at the beautiful Palace at Somerset Park in Somerset, NJ
  • Reaching a milestone of 100 Certified Floodplain Managers (CFM) in New Jersey
  • Providing discounts on training classes about elevation certificates and Community Rating System (CRS), as well as discounts for classes given by others
  • Holding review couse and exam opportunities at least twice a year for floodplain managers wishing to participate in the ASFPM Certified Floodplain Manager Program
  • Providing scholarship opportunities for local floodplain management administrators and CRS coordinators
  • Distributing timely emails on information specific to local floodplain administrators and floodplain managers
  • Delivering biannual informational newsletters directly to your inbox
  • Continuing development of the NJAFM webpage at www.njafm.org
  • Sending news listings specifically related to floodplain management to your inbox
  • And much more!!!

In addition to all of this, membership in the NJAFM magnifies your voice on issues of importance to floodplain professionals.
